When it comes to the weight of a bunch of cilantro, the exact amount can vary based on several factors such as the size of the bunch and the density of the leaves. On average, a standard bunch of cilantro typically weighs around 1 to 2 ounces (28 to 56 grams). However, it's essential to keep in mind that the weight can fluctuate depending on.

Some simple measurements made us realize that most grocery stores will have bunches of cilantro with an average weight of 2.8 ounces. This all translates into about 93 springs of cilantro in every bunch. One regular grocery store "bunch" of cilantro produces between 3/4 - 1 cup loose packed & chopped cilantro leaves. I have often used about 1/4 loose packed & chopped cup = 1/4 "bunch" of cilantro and have found that an appropriate amount for many recipes.

A bunch of cilantro is considered 3/4 of a cup If you are purchasing cilantro from the grocery store that has not been chopped. When minced, you need to have one cup to equal a bunch. When it comes to dried cilantro, less is more, a bunch is around two tablespoons. The term bunch changes depending on how your cilantro has been prepared.

When you purchase cilantro from the grocery store or market, it typically comes in a bunch, with the roots still intact. A standard bunch of cilantro usually contains about one cup of loosely packed leaves and stems. This translates to roughly one ounce by weight, making it easy to estimate the amount of cilantro needed for your recipe.

What shouldn't be surprising is that a bunch isn't an exact measurement. If a bunch sounds like, essentially, a handful, you'd be correct. So, the amount in a bunch will vary.
